Noble, WA: CRIMINAL RECORD EXPUNGE INFO
A rap sheet occurs whenever an individual is convicted of a crime by a court. The criminal conviction will normally constantly remain on the individual's state criminal record till a legal motion (demand) to vacate conviction is brought under RCW 9.96.060 prior to the same court after a certain period. For many criminal misdemeanor & gross misdemeanor convictions, the time period is normally 3 to 5 years after court probation ends and after all financial obligations owed to the court have been completely pleased. And there must not be any brand-new criminal convictions/ charges/ arrests given that the conviction sought to be vacated. If all these preconditions are satisfied, many community & district courts will normally approve movements to vacate a criminal conviction. That results in the individual no longer having a rap sheet for that specific conviction.
An individual whose criminal conviction is vacated may lawfully state on future job applications that he/she has never had a rap sheet.
Under RCW 9.96.060, an individual is restricted to only one getaway of a misdemeanor criminal conviction. Convictions for DUIs and particular misdemeanor sex crimes can not be vacated.
Nonconviction data (police arrest records, jail booking records, fingerprints/ pictures (mugshots) records, etc) take place whenever an individual is arrested/jailed but no criminal charges are ever filed in court. Such nonconviction data are held by Washington State law enforcement agencies for several years. Local detaining police companies & the Washington State Patrol Criminal History Section in Olympia, WA both retain nonconviction data.
Under RCW 10.97.060 and WAC 446-16-025, persons may make written demands to expunge/delete such police nonconviction data. These demands must be made to both the regional detaining police company and to the Washington State Patrol Criminal History Section in Olympia, WA. Such demands will normally be granted if there have been no charges within two years of the nonconviction data sought to be erased, and over 3 years have passed given that the date of the old arrest
The website for the Washington State Criminal History Section is http://www.wsp.wa.gov/crime/crimhist.htm.
Nonconviction data, like criminal conviction records, can also be utilized by property owners to reject rental real estate/ apartment or condos and by employers to reject job applications, job promotions, and so on.
